May 31, 2004blogging and assumptions about classWe've all heard the rhetoric about how blogging is an equal-access opportunity for publication because many services are free. Yet, embedded in the creation of those services are a lot of assumptions about money and time and how people spend these precious items. Nothing made me more pleased after re-installing Shrook than seeing Quinn calling folks out on these assumptions, particularly as services begin to charge and the pundits start heckling people for bitching about the cost. Just think... $60 will pay for a full year of education for a student via the Goma Student Fund. Money is *very* relative. Category: Posted by zephoria at May 31, 2004 1:47 PM
